Skip to main content

List All Tokens

Retrieves a list of all tokens (without detailed information)
POST/isp/token/list

Authentication

Basic user:pass authentication

Request Body

status
Required
Type:string
Description:

Filter tokens by status

Validation:

Must be "active", "expired", "deleted", or "processing"

Code Example

const axios = require('axios');

const url = "https://api.unknownproxies.com/api/v1/isp/token/list";
const headers = {
"Authorization": "Basic dXNlcjpwYXNz",
"Content-Type": "application/json"
};
const data = {
"status": "active"
};

try {
const response = await axios.post(url, {
headers,
data
});
console.log(response.data);
} catch (error) {
console.error('Error:', error.response?.data || error.message);
}

Response Example

[
    {
        "authType": "ip",
        "authenticatedIps": [
            "123.123.123.123"
        ],
        "createdAt": 1754286589,
        "dataUsage": 20964502,
        "durationHours": 720,
        "password": "newpass22",
        "product": "TICK",
        "proxies": [
            "145.111.111.111:35115"
        ],
        "proxyType": "socks",
        "quantity": 1,
        "region": "US",
        "status": "active",
        "token": "HG5zl2QURXJF",
        "updatedAt": 1754342102,
        "username": "newusernam2"
    }
  ]

Status Filters

You can filter tokens by status:

  • active - Tokens ready for use
  • expired - Tokens that have run out of duration hours (see Renew Token to extend)
  • deleted - Tokens manually deactivated via Delete Token
  • processing - Tokens currently being created

Working with Listed Tokens